Key Factors to Consider When Choosing Corporate Event Photographers
When selecting a photographer, focus on these essential factors to ensure you get the best results:
1. Portfolio and Style
Review their portfolio carefully. Look for consistency in image quality and style. Do their photos match the tone you want for your event? For example, if your brand is formal and polished, the photographer’s work should reflect that. If you prefer a more relaxed and candid style, check for natural, spontaneous shots.
2. Experience with Corporate Events
Experience matters. Photographers familiar with corporate events understand the flow and key moments to capture. They know how to work discreetly and efficiently in busy environments. Ask about their previous corporate clients and event types.
3. Equipment and Technical Skills
Professional photographers use high-quality cameras, lenses, and lighting equipment. This ensures sharp images even in challenging lighting conditions. Confirm that they have backup gear to avoid any disruptions.
4. Communication and Collaboration
Good communication is vital. The photographer should listen to your needs and offer suggestions. They should be easy to reach before and after the event. A collaborative approach leads to better results.
5. Pricing and Packages
Understand their pricing structure. Some photographers offer packages that include editing, prints, or digital galleries. Make sure the package fits your budget and requirements. Avoid surprises by clarifying what is included.
How to Prepare for Your Corporate Event Photography Session
Preparation helps the photographer deliver the best results. Here are some tips to get ready:
Share your event schedule: Provide a detailed timeline so the photographer knows when key moments will happen.
Discuss branding elements: Inform them about logos, colour schemes, and any specific shots you want.
Choose the right venue: Ensure the location has good lighting or discuss additional lighting needs with the photographer.
Plan for group photos: Decide in advance who should be included and where these photos will take place.
Communicate dress code: Let attendees know if there is a specific dress code to maintain a consistent look.
By preparing well, you help the photographer capture your event smoothly and effectively.
